The most common issue with 3GP files today is non-playing audio, almost always caused by codec incompatibility rather than corruption, since many modern players, browsers, and editors skip AMR audio due to licensing or workflow limits, allowing the video to play while rejecting the audio so it seems absent even though it’s simply unsupported.
Another crucial factor involves cross-device harmony, contrasting with early mobile fragmentation where different networks needed different formats; MP4 took over because it works everywhere and handles many quality levels, so 3GPP2 survives mainly in legacy data like old phone backups, MMS collections, voicemail systems, and regulated archives that preserve original files for historical correctness.
When we say 3GPP2 prioritizes small file size and reliability over visual quality, we’re describing a purposeful engineering decision shaped by the harsh limits of early mobile tech, where CDMA networks were slow, bandwidth costly, and phones had very little processing power or storage, so the format used aggressive compression, low resolution, and speech-focused audio to ensure clips could be recorded, sent, and played reliably, even though this resulted in pixelation and softness on today’s high-resolution screens.

Reliability was just as vital as reducing size, leading 3GPP2 to be structured with timing and indexing capable of handling network instability, keeping playback synchronized through rough conditions, making reliable low-quality clips more useful than glitchy high-quality ones, and resulting in a format that seems primitive today yet persists because it remains small, steady, and accessible after many years.
